An industry leader in the Aerospace manufacturing sector is seeking a strong Manufacturing Engineer to join their ever-growing team in NJ. Reporting directly to the division VP of Engineering, this position will support the development and improvement of production workflows, including work instructions, build documentation, tools, fixtures, and equipment required for product manufacturing.

The Manufacturing Engineer will have the following responsibilities:

  • Lead the planning, development, and implementation of advanced manufacturing processes and lean cell layouts for both new production and overhaul/repair operations, ensuring alignment with aerospace and hydraulic system standards.
  • Spearhead cross-functional initiatives to identify, justify, and procure precision tooling, test equipment, and automation solutions to enhance production efficiency and quality.
  • Establish and continuously refine production standards, work instructions, and build documentation to support scalable and repeatable manufacturing of electromechanical assemblies.
  • Provide hands-on support in diagnosing and resolving complex mechanical, electrical, and hydraulic system failures, collaborating with design and test engineering teams.
  • Review and validate engineering drawings and CAD models for manufacturability, initiating Engineering Change Orders (ECOs) to optimize design-for-manufacturing (DFM) and design-for-assembly (DFA) principles.
  • Witness and evaluate acceptance testing of aerospace components and systems, ensuring compliance with performance specifications and test protocol accuracy.
  • Drive continuous improvement initiatives using Six Sigma, Kaizen, and root cause analysis methodologies to enhance product reliability and reduce cycle times.
  • Translate engineering Bills of Materials (EBOMs) into accurate and structured Manufacturing BOMs (MBOMs), integrating ERP and PLM systems for traceability and configuration control.
  • Conduct and/or witness qualification, performance, and environmental testing of new products, including vibration, thermal cycling, humidity, and duty cycle validation per aerospace standards (e.g., DO-160, MIL-STD).
  • Develop comprehensive test plans and author detailed test reports to support product validation, regulatory compliance, and customer deliverables.
  • Perform internal audits across manufacturing, quality, and engineering departments to ensure adherence to AS9100, ISO 9001, and internal process controls.
